AI transforms creative industries, paper finds

A new research paper, "Dream machine -- the next creative economy," analyzes the impact of generative AI on creative industries, drawing on extensive data and surveys. The paper identifies the "slop ceiling" as a quality threshold limiting AI-generated content and highlights significant tensions between tech firms and creative workers, particularly regarding AI training rights. It also details how major studios like Disney and Netflix are integrating AI into their production pipelines and proposes principles for a human-centered transition, including transparency, consent, and compensation.
